Transient Stability Analysis of Auxiliary Power System for Nuclear Power Plant Based on ETAP Simulation
Taking No.3 and No.4 units in Tianwan Nuclear Power Plant as examples, a simulation using ETAP software was performed on auxiliary power system, according to the four kinds of transient condition requirements proposed by Russian design institute. The simulation results show that the design of auxiliary power connection scheme can meet the requirements for power transient stability put forward by Russian party. The ETAP analysis report on transient stability has obtained a unanimous approval of the general designer and the owner. And the simulation results has filled the design gaps in electrical transient analysis for nuclear power plant in China, realizing a progress from static estimation to transient stability simulation.
